Shear Thinning of a Critical Viscoelastic Fluid

Abstract

The frequency and shear dependent critical viscosity at a correlation length =-1, has the form η=η0-xηG(z1,z2), where z1 and z2 are the independent dimensionless numbers in the problem defined as z1=-iω203 and z2=-iω20c3. The decay rate of critical fluctuations of correlation length -1 is 03 and kc is the effective wave number for which 0kc3=S, the shear rate. The function G(z1,z2) is calculated in a one loop self-consistent theory.
